ECCRC provides literacy help for adults & children, Resume Writing help, job search assistance, Technology Certificate program, computer skills workshops, community food bank & Thanksgiving fox box distribution, E-Bay Workshops, Creative Writing Workshops, AA groups, Grief Support groups,  Job-Loss Support groups, and Case Management services for assistance with GED Preparation, High School online diploma completion programs, and resources for home-school and private school families.

Our programs are offered to you free of charge or for a low workshop fee.ECCRC receives no Government funding and these services are made possible by public donations. Pay it forward when you can. THANKS! ECCRC, PO Box 40, Dexter, KS 67038.

Lynn started the ECCELL Diploma Completion Program that is in Sumner, Cowley, and Chautauqua Counties in Kansas and she served as the Education Specialist in Wichita for the Mental Health Association of South Central Kansas where she developed and implemented the Education program for that large association. She is a licensed Secondary English Teacher and serves as the Director of ECCRC. She has taught college English courses at Cowley College, KS and at Wayne College, NC. She serves as the Editor/Publisher of the ADVOCATE . Lynn is currently completing a second manuscript,  Get Your College Degree: A Non-Traditional Guide. A portion of the proceeds from Lynn's writing projects go to help fund ECCRC. Lynn has left the corporate world in order to donate more time to ECCRC projects this summer and to her local community.
